Range and Grazing Notes, 1940-1941

 File — Box: 2, Folder: 12

Scope and Contents

Includes the following:

  1. Interview with John W. Thornley, Kaysville, Utah, conducted by C.C. Anderson and John D. Thornley
  2. Interview with W.J. Thornley, Layton, Utah, conducted by C.C. Anderson and John D. Thornley
  3. Letter to C.C. Anderson from L.C. Montgomery
  4. Excerpts from The Story of the Range by Will C. Barnes
  5. "The Santa Fe Trail" by J.F. Farrell
  6. "Forest and Range Resources of Utah," prepared by the Forest Service, Intermountain Region
  7. "Profits in Farming on Irrigated Areas in Utah Lake Valley" by E.H. Thomson and H.M. Dixon
  8. "What the National Forests Mean to the Intermountain Region" by Frederick S. Baker
  9. "History of Grazing on the Plains" report
